At 6 Apr 2000 15:18:02 GMT, Nik Clayton <nik@freebsd.org> wrote: > We can add attributes to certain elements, specifying > the language and encoding: > > <descr lang="en_US.ISO_8859-1">...</descr> > > <descr lang="ja_JP.eucJP">...</descr> > > and so on. That's one way, I'm sure there are others. Any suggestions? It may not work. If we have some encodings in one file, editors cannot recognize the encoding of that file.
